↑Jump back a sectionFinnish
Etymology
A medieval vernacular form of Elisabet, equivalent to English Elizabeth, ultimately from Hebrew.
Pronunciation
- IPA: [ˈliːsɑ]
- Hyphenation: Lii‧sa
Proper noun
Liisa
- A female given name; also a popular latter part of hyphenated names such as Anna-Liisa or Eeva-Liisa.
- Alice, the heroine of Lewis Carroll's books.
